Item 5.02
Departure of Directors or Principal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Principal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

Effective as of December 3, 2021, Eric Murphy, Ph.D. will cease serving as the Chief Scientific Officer of Kinnate Biopharma Inc. (the “Company”) and begin serving as a member of the Company’s Scientific Advisory Board (the “SAB”).  Dr. Murphy will be paid an hourly fee for his service on the SAB based on his experience and qualifications commensurate with the fees paid to other members of the SAB.

Item 8.01
Other Events

On October 28, 2021, the Company issued a press release announcing the transition of Dr. Murphy from Chief Scientific Officer of the Company to member of the SAB.  The full text of the press release is attached as Exhibit 99.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and is incorporated herein by reference.
